Replica of a key found in Skriðuklaustur, comes in silver or oxidized silver.

The original key was found in an excavation at Skriðuklaustur in Fljótsdalshreppur. The beautiful key is made of bronze mixture and is now preserved at the National Museum of Iceland.
The key was found in the church in the remains of wood, which according to analysis were made of a linden tree and could have been from a small chest.

This replica is made by Ingi Bjarnason an Icelandic Goldsmith that founded the well-known Jewelry brand Sign.
